Types of Ovens
Ovens come in a variety of types, each accommodating particular cooking requirements. Here are the most common types:
| Type of Oven | Description |
|---|---|
| Standard Oven | Makes use of heating elements at the top and bottom for cooking, perfect for baking and roasting. |
| Stove | Functions a fan that flows hot air, leading to even cooking and quicker baking. |
| Microwave | Uses electromagnetic waves to heat food quickly, perfect for reheating and defrosting. |
| Steam oven hob | Cooks food using steam, protecting moisture and nutrients, perfect for healthy cooking. |
| Wall Oven | Built into the wall, saving flooring area while providing contemporary cooking functions. |
| Variety Oven | Combines both an oven and cooking hobs, typically found in expert cooking areas. |
Kinds of Hobs
Hobs, frequently described as cooktops, are offered in numerous forms. Here are the significant types:
| Type of Hob | Description |
|---|---|
| Electric Hob | Operates using electric heating elements, easy to clean and available in different designs. |
| Gas Hob | Supplies instant heat and exact temperature level control, ideal for traditional cooking enthusiasts. |
| Induction Hob | Utilizes electromagnetic technology to heat pans straight, making sure faster cooking and energy effectiveness. |
| Ceramic Hob | Functions a smooth surface area that is simple to tidy; offers both electric and induction alternatives. |
| Modular Hob | Allows personalization of the cooking surface, integrating various types like grills, wok burners, and frying zones. |
Secret Features to Consider
When searching for ovens and hobs, there are a number of important functions to take into consideration to guarantee you select the very best home appliances for your requirements:
Ovens:
- Size and Capacity: Consider the interior measurements to accommodate larger meals or numerous trays all at once.
- Energy Efficiency: Look for Energy Star scores or comparable accreditations that show lower energy consumption.
- Self-Cleaning Options: Many modern ovens included self-cleaning features, making upkeep a lot easier.
- Smart Technology: Wi-Fi-enabled ovens enable remote controlling and monitoring through mobile apps.
- Several Cooking Modes: Versatile cooking choices such as broil, bake, roast, and steam enhance functionality.
Hobs:
- Heat Sources: Determine your preferred cooking approach (gas, electric, induction) based on convenience and cooking design.
- Security Features: Automatic shut-off or child-lock functions are vital for homes with children.
- Control Types: Touch controls versus knobs can substantially change the user experience; pick what feels comfy.
- Cleaning Ease: Look for hobs with smooth surfaces or removable elements for simpler cleaning.
- Zone Flexibility: Modular or flex zones enable bigger pots and pans, enhancing versatility.

Frequently asked questions
What is the distinction between a steam oven and a traditional oven?
A steam oven cooks food using steam, preserving wetness and nutrients, while a traditional oven utilizes dry heat from heating aspects.
Is induction cooking safe?
Yes, induction cooking is thought about safe as the cooktop remains cool to the touch even while cooking, substantially decreasing the danger of burns.
Can I utilize routine cookware on an induction hob?
No, just pots and pans made of ferrous (magnetic) materials is compatible with induction hobs. Look for induction compatibility before acquiring.

How do I clean a ceramic hob?
Permit the hob to cool, then wipe the surface with a moist cloth and a mild Kitchen Essentials cleaner. Prevent using abrasive scrubbers that can scratch the surface area.
What maintenance do ovens need?
Regular upkeep consists of cleaning up spills, examining seals for damage, and scheduling expert maintenance for more complex problems.
